Tomato Basil Pasta

A simple and flavorful pasta dish made with fresh tomatoes, basil, and garlic, perfect for a quick weeknight dinner.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: Italian
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

Pasta
  • 12 oz spaghetti or any pasta of choice
Sauce
  • 2 tbsp olive oil extra virgin
  • 3 cloves garlic minced
  • 4 cups cherry tomatoes halved
  • 1 cup fresh basil chopped
  • 1 tsp salt to taste
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per to taste
  • 1/4 cup parmesan cheese grated, optional

Method
 

Cooking the Pasta
  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add spaghetti and cook according to package instructions until al dente.
  2. Drain the pasta in a colander and set aside, reserving a cup of pasta water.
Making the Sauce
  1.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
  2. Add halved cherry tomatoes and cook for about 5-7 minutes until they start to soften.
  3. Stir in chopped basil, salt, and pepper. Cook for another 2 minutes.
  4. Add the cooked pasta to the skillet, tossing to combine. If the mixture is too dry, add reserved pasta water a little at a time.
  5. Serve hot, topped with grated parmesan cheese if desired.
